## Releases

Each Bramblegate release bundles the updated connection-pool defaults for the Harlowe database tier. Review the pool sizing notes in `docs/pooling` before promoting a build, since a misconfigured maximum can exhaust backend connections under load. Release artifacts are built deterministically and must be verified prior to deployment. Verification is performed against the release signing key shown below.

deploy key for kajof-fajop: bky6_gDHw9Q

FAQ — Why did my incremental rebuild fail on Pagewright? Incremental rebuilds only regenerate pages whose content hashes changed since the last successful run. If the hash cache is corrupted, Pagewright falls back to a full rebuild, which can exceed the build window and fail. Support staff can reset the cache from the maintenance console, but the console requires elevated recovery access after three failed resets. When prompted at that point, supply the recovery passphrase shown below.

vault phrase of tajef-tafog = istox-sorax-zorox-casok-holox-kelix-weneth-drueth-casion

### PR: Fix planner regression on wide joins

This reverts the cardinality-estimate change that caused Queryforge to prefer nested-loop joins on wide fact tables, producing the latency spikes you paged on last week. The fix restores the hash-join preference and adds guardrails so estimates can't undershoot below a floor. If spikes recur, these are the knobs to adjust; current values follow.

tuning table, faduf-baduf:
PRIORITIES = {
    "ulavan": 191,
    "silys": 750,
    "goriel": 238,
    "kelmir": 66,
    "wendor": 432,
}